This weeks theme is: Top Ten Books on my Fall TBR List
The Paradox by Charlie Fletcher – This is the sequel to The Oversight. I really enjoyed that book and am very much looking forward to returning to the engrossing world that Charlie Fletcher created. I can’t wait to see what happened to Sarah Falk and Mr. Sharp as they went into the world within the mirrors and I’m hoping their relationship will be further developed in this book too.
The Bazaar of Bad Dreams by Stephen King – You can sign me up for any new offering from Stephen King, so am certainly awaiting the release of this book of short stories.
Lair of Dreams by Libba Bray – The Diviners sequel! How could I not have this on my list when the first book was one of my favourite recent reads. I can’t wait to get back into the magical, dangerous world of Evie O’Neill and her friends.
Wolf Hall by Hilary Mantel – I’ve been watching the tv series (it’s really good) and it’s made me want to read the book.
Bring up the Bodies by Hilary Mantel – Assuming I enjoy the first book I’ll definitely move on to the second.
Salem’s Lot by Stephen King – Autumn wouldn’t be Autumn without a Stephen King novel or two to lose myself in on a cool, gloomy, foggy afternoon (looking out the window right now as I write this, today would be perfect!). I’m hoping to read this one as part of R.I.P X.
Thief’s Magic by Trudi Canavan – A new-to-me author I’ve read good things about so I thought I’d start with this novel.
Promise of Blood by Brian McClellan – Saw this one while I was wandering around the bookstore and was first taken in by the cover but the premise sounds original and interesting too.
Half the World by Joe Abercrombie – I read the first in this series earlier this year and enjoyed it a lot.
A Court of Thorns and Roses by Sarah J. Maas – I’ve had an idea that I’d like to read this one for a while now, and the library recently added it to their catalogue so I put myself on the request list straight away.
